The best mouse or keyboard for your setup depends on how you work, play, and travel. This roundup covers options ranging from the quiet, portable Logitech Pebble and affordable Logitech M325C to the customizable Logitech G502 Lightspeed gaming mouse. We also consider a colorful My Little Pony model, the budget-focused Redragon M606, and the compact YUNZII C98 mechanical keyboard.

A slim, quiet wireless mouse for laptops, shared offices, and travel. Bluetooth and USB-receiver support make it versatile, but the flat shape is not ideal for long workdays.

A feature-rich wireless gaming mouse with a precise HERO sensor, adjustable weight, RGB lighting, and extensive button customization—best for right-handed users who like a substantial grip.

A colorful Twilight Sparkle mouse with quiet clicks, 1600 DPI tracking, and Bluetooth or 2.4GHz connectivity. Best for casual computing and themed desk setups.

The YUNZII C98 combines mechanical keys, wireless operation, and a space-conscious layout. It is promising for work and casual gaming, but verify the switch and connectivity options before buying.
